Quarterly Planning Note — Divestiture of the Coastal Tooling Unit

For the finance team: the sale of the Coastal Tooling unit to Pellmark Industries remains on track for close in Q3. Please finalize the carve-out balance sheet, reconcile intercompany positions, and prepare the working-capital adjustment schedule by month-end. Audit support requests should be prioritized. For planning purposes, note the following sensitive item:

internal memo for hawef-kahif: The finance team signed off on a budget of $25.9 million for Project Sorox. The renewal with Pelokek Logistics closes at $51.7 million a year, 52 percent below the last contract.

14:22 — The Hollowgrain transcoding farm began rejecting new jobs after the scheduler exhausted its worker lease pool. Operators confirmed that a misconfigured retry policy, introduced in the morning deploy, was re-leasing failed workers indefinitely. The deploy was rolled back at 14:31 and job intake recovered within four minutes. The offending deploy is identified by the trace token below.

pipeline stamp: htk3_a71

Following the Grelburn Components outage in March, procurement has been qualifying a second source for the valve assemblies used in the Norwick line. Three candidates remain: Altavere Precision, Stonnybrook Fabrication, and a smaller shop near Kellermarsh. Sample runs are due back within three weeks; pricing from Altavere looks competitive but lead times are unproven. Branch managers should not commit volumes to any candidate yet. The strategic context, summarised below, must stay within this group.

internal memo for yahag-hahig: Belwynix Group plans to lower the Silir list price by 62 percent in May.